Swerving Hard – Bye Bye Skeletons, Hello Exploding Corpses

Scrapped the minion plan quick. Checked my skills again. Saw Corpse Explosion hiding there. Thought, “Why carry friends when you can blow up dead enemies?” This felt right.

Dropped all points out of minions, poured everything into:

  • Bone Splinters (Basic Skill): Just something to poke with and build Essence.
  • Reap (Generate Corpses FAST): This became my bread and butter. Just spam Reap in a group, bam, corpses everywhere.
  • Corpse Explosion: My new best friend. Highlighted it, maxed it out. See corpse? Blow it up. See another corpse? Blow that up. Chain reactions felt amazing.
  • Blood Mist: Safety net button. Got surrounded? Pop Mist, float through everyone, drop a few corpses (thanks to a specific passive), explode my way out. Life saver.

Gameplay got WAY smoother. Run into group, Reap-Reap-Reap, see corpses pop, spam Corpse Explosion button. Screen filled with blasts, enemies melted. Kept moving fast.

Gear & Glyphs – Stuff I Actually Looked For

Knowing what to grab makes leveling faster. While blasting through zones:

  • Weapons: Anything boosting Vulnerable damage? Grab it. Found a sweet 2H Scythe early with this, huge damage jump on Corpse Explosion.
  • Armor: Pieces with “+ Corpse Explosion rank” became instant favorites. More ranks, bigger booms.
  • Aspects: Got lucky finding one that made corpses explode in a line. More clearing power for tight dungeons.
  • Glyphs (Level 50+): Priority was sockets for the Dexterity ones boosting damage after killing a vulnerable enemy. Pure damage focus.

Didn’t bother picking up every blue item past level 30. Stopped for yellows, checked for key stats, trash the rest. Vendors became besties for quick cash and upgrades. Skipped unnecessary dungeons – stuck to the main Season Journey objectives and Whisper tree stuff. Why do extra?
